It is my understanding that if we do upgrade to JAX-WS 2.1 we will be
breaking Java EE 5 TCK (becuase there are some additional API in
JAX-WS 2.1 / JAX-B 2.1). Also, since JAX-WS 2.1 requires JAX-B 2.1 and
in Geronimo we use JAX-B in a bunch of components, upgrading them
might take a little bit of time and effort to make sure everything
still works as supposed to.
